U324391493 leak post #3239652 – NSFW photos & videos by u324391493

u324391493 profile picture
@u324391493 ·
u324391493 leak post #3239652 image 1

Likes: 0 · Comments: 0

Description

Leap Day

Comments

You must be signed in to comment.